The Role of Readiness in Roadside Safety

Roadside preparedness involves cognitive awareness, practical skills, and physical resources. When a mechanical breakdown or incident occurs, driver panic often stems from a lack of control. An emergency kit provides an immediate set of action options, mitigating stress and enabling logical decision-making under pressure.

Reducing Exposure Time on Dangerous Roads

The primary danger during a vehicle breakdown is secondary collisions. Vehicles parked on the shoulder of high-speed highways face substantial risk from passing traffic.

  • Rapid Hazard Deployment: Reflector triangles and LED flares allow drivers to signal their presence immediately, alerting approaching motorists from hundreds of feet away.

  • Minimized Exit Frequency: A organized kit ensures tools are accessible without forcing the driver to rummage through a trunk while exposed to traffic.

  • Efficient Tire Changes: Portable air compressors and proper lug wrenches decrease the time spent on the shoulder during tire failures.

Decreasing the duration a vehicle remains stationary on a shoulder reduces the probability of a secondary crash.

Essential Components of a Complete Roadside Emergency Kit

A comprehensive emergency kit balances mechanical repair tools, personal survival gear, and signaling equipment. Relying on basic factory accessories is rarely sufficient for complex emergencies.

Mechanical and Electrical Recovery Tools

Vehicle failures frequently involve electrical drain or tire deflation. Having dedicated tools prevents total loss of mobility.

  • Jumper Cables or Portable Jump Starters: Dead batteries represent one of the most common causes of vehicle disablement. Heavy-gauge jumper cables allow assistance from other vehicles, while lithium-ion jump packs allow self-recovery without a second automobile.

  • Tire Pressure Gauge and Inflator: Maintaining proper tire inflation prevents blowouts. A portable 12-volt air compressor permits drivers to inflate a low tire enough to reach a service station.

  • Tire Sealant and Plug Kits: Minor punctures from nails can be temporarily sealed on-site without removing the wheel.

  • Basic Hand Tools: Adjustable wrenches, screwdrivers, pliers, and duct tape facilitate temporary fixes for loose hoses, shields, or battery terminals.

Visibility and Signaling Devices

Visibility is critical, particularly at night, during fog, or in heavy precipitation. Passing motorists require clear visual warnings to yield space.

  • LED Road Flares and Reflective Triangles: Unlike chemical flares, electronic flares offer reusable, long-lasting illumination without fire hazard risks near leaking fluids.

  • High-Visibility Vest: Wearing reflective clothing ensures the driver remains visible to traffic while working outside the vehicle.

  • High-Lumen Flashlight or Headlamp: Working in darkness requires hands-free illumination. A quality headlamp directs light to the engine bay or wheel well while keeping hands free.

Survival and Personal Comfort Supplies

When breakdowns occur in extreme weather or isolated locations, immediate rescue may take hours. Survival supplies protect occupants from environment-related injury.

  • First Aid Kit: Should include sterile gauze, antiseptic wipes, adhesive bandages, medical tape, shears, and burn cream to treat minor injuries incurred during travel or repair attempts.

  • Mylar Thermal Blankets: Compact thermal blankets reflect up to 90 percent of body heat, offering protection against hypothermia in freezing conditions.

  • Non-Perishable Food and Water: Calorie-dense energy bars and purified water pouches provide nourishment during extended stranding periods.

  • Work Gloves: Heavy-duty leather or nitrile gloves protect hands from sharp metal, hot engine parts, and caustic chemicals.

Customizing Kits for Environmental and Regional Risks

A single kit design does not fit every geography or season. True preparedness requires tailoring contents to environmental conditions.

Winter Climate Preparedness

Vehicles operating in regions subject to ice, snow, and sub-freezing temperatures require specialized winter gear:

  • Folding Shovel and Traction Mats: Essential for digging out tires caught in snowdrifts or ice patches.

  • Ice Scraper and Snow Brush: Ensures clear sightlines before driving.

  • Hand Warmers and Wool Blankets: Provides supplementary heat when running the engine is unsafe due to snow blocking the exhaust pipe.

Desert and High-Heat Adaptations

Extreme heat creates distinct risks, including severe dehydration and engine overheating:

  • Excess Coolant and Water: Crucial for managing cooling system demands or replenishing lost fluids.

  • Sun Protection: Wide-brimmed hats, sunscreen, and UV umbrellas protect stranded occupants from heatstroke while awaiting rescue.

Maintenance and Seasonal Inspections of Emergency Kits

An emergency kit is only effective if its components are fully functional. Regular inspections prevent component failure during a crisis.

  • Battery Maintenance: Flashlights and jump packs discharge over time. Recharging electronic items every three to six months guarantees operational readiness.

  • Expiration Date Audits: First aid supplies, food rations, and chemical sealants carry shelf lives. Expired items must be replaced systematically.

  • Seasonal Adjustments: Swap winter shovels and thermal gear for summer hydration supplies twice a year to match weather risks.

FAQ

What are the most vital items every basic roadside kit must include?

A core emergency kit should always include heavy-gauge jumper cables or a portable battery jump starter, a bright flashlight or headlamp, reflective safety triangles, a high-visibility vest, a first aid kit, and a tire pressure gauge with a portable air inflator.

How often should a driver inspect their roadside emergency kit?

Drivers should conduct a full inspection of their kit at least twice a year. Inspections should verify battery charge levels on electronic devices, check expiration dates on food and medical supplies, and ensure seasonal gear matches upcoming weather patterns.

Is a factory-installed spare tire kit sufficient for roadside emergencies?

Factory kits usually contain only a basic jack and lug wrench meant strictly for tire swaps. They lack essential safety items like reflective markers, personal protective equipment, jump-starting tools, and medical supplies necessary for broader emergency scenarios.

Where is the safest place to store an emergency kit inside a car?

The emergency kit should be stored in an easily accessible area of the trunk or cargo compartment. Ensure it is secured so it does not become a loose projectile during sudden stops, and avoid placing heavy luggage directly on top of it.

Can a portable power bank start a vehicle with a dead battery?

Standard phone charging power banks cannot start a vehicle because they lack sufficient cranking amperage. However, dedicated portable lithium-ion jump-starter packs are designed specifically to provide the high peak amperage required to start an engine independently.

How does having an emergency kit lower the risk of secondary highway accidents?

Emergency kits contain visibility gear such as reflective triangles, LED flares, and bright vests. Deploying these items alerts passing traffic far in advance, giving motorists time to slow down or change lanes, which drastically reduces the chance of a rear-end or side-sweep collision.

What extra items should be added to a roadside kit when traveling with children or pets?

When traveling with dependents or pets, add extra bottled water, specialized non-perishable snacks, necessary prescription medications, infant formula, extra diapers, comfort blankets, and portable water bowls to handle unexpected delays safely.
